System Compatibility Legacy Support : Drivers are available for Windows XP, Vista, and 7 : Full 32-bit and 64-bit support for Windows 10 and 11 : Requires a USB 2.0 High Speed connection for direct tethering or a 10/100BaseTX Ethernet port for network-wide driver deployment.
